Structure‐Tunable Fluorinated Polyester Electrolytes with Enhanced Interfacial Stability for Recyclable Solid‐State Lithium Metal Batteries

open access: yesAdvanced Materials, EarlyView.
Fluorinated polyesters are shown to regulate lithium‐ion coordination and promote stable electrode–electrolyte interfaces. The rational structural design enables uniform lithium deposition, suppressed dendrite growth, and enhanced cycling performance in lithium‐metal batteries.

High‐Performance Air‐Stable Polymer Monolayer Transistors for Monolithic 3D CMOS logics

open access: yesAdvanced Materials, EarlyView.
A fibrillar polymer monolayer with a self‐confinement effect is demonstrated, in which aligned chains parallel the nanofiber axis. Employing a top‐gate CYTOP dielectric, this monolayer transistor achieves high mobility (7.12 cm2 V−1 s−1) and exceptional stability over 1260 days in air.

Effect of tillage and precision nutrient placement on enhanced yield, productivity and profitability of maize (Zea mays)

open access: yesThe Indian Journal of Agricultural Sciences
Minimum tillage led to improved growth and yield attributes, resulting in significantly higher grain and straw yields compared to conventional tillage, while being statistically similar to zero tillage.
